After testing this all day in a few different ways, I am going to preliminarily call this firmware update a big success! Here are 3 examples:

Kitchen/Dining Room AP

image

The one above is near my kitchen, and you can clearly see fluctuations throughout the day. I did not in any way try to influence the AQI on this one. It’s all natural. You can definitely tell when my wife made dinner and cookies today with the slight bumps in AQI, and slight variations throughout the day. This is exactly how I expected it should look!


Office AP

image

This one purposely blew a bunch of air freshener near the AP to purposely make the AQI shoot up high to ensure it was correctly capturing the data. As you can see above, it updated as expected. It also had slight variations throughout the rest of the day. Very happy with the results here.


Toddler’s Room in Sleep Mode

image

I basically left the above AP in sleep mode all day long. It’s fairly isolated and the AQI usually stays pretty low with rare fluctuation. Even then, you can see there was a small change around 8am just after she left to daycare. So even when it’s stuck on the low sleepmode setting, it still updated the AQI even though the fan speed and mode shouldn’t have changed.
